The business, in plain words · what the numbers mean

Insurance giants fail our ethical line

Picture a Canadian insurer collecting premiums from families across Asia and North America. Sun Life does exactly that yet it lands on our excluded list because diversified insurance sits outside our ethical screen.

We pass for that single reason. The numbers add little temptation anyway. Revenue is flat, the narrow moat offers slim protection and the shares trade eight percent above our fair value with a forward multiple of 13.5 times that leaves scant margin.

Analyst targets sit well below the current price and returns on equity remain modest. Currency moves and regulatory shifts in multiple markets add further uncertainty. Analysis, not advice.
